Summary

In nopCommerce 4.50.1, an open redirect vulnerability can be triggered by luring a user to authenticate to a nopCommerce page by clicking on a crafted link.

Risk Assessment

The risk involves potential phishing attacks where users may be redirected to a malicious external site, leading to credential theft or exposure of sensitive information.

Recommendation

It is recommended to upgrade nopCommerce to the latest version that includes a fix for the open redirect vulnerability. Additionally, implement validation and restrict allowed URLs in redirect parameters.
